Question
2hcl + mg → mgcl₂ + h₂
what is the heat of the reaction?
qₛₒₗₙ = +9240 j
qᵣₓₙ = − qₛₒₗₙ
qᵣₓₙ = ? j
enter either a + or - sign and the magnitude.
notice this example does not have a calorimeter constant calculation.
Step1: Identify the formula
We know that \( q_{\text{rxn}} = - q_{\text{soln}} \).
Step2: Substitute the value of \( q_{\text{soln}} \)
Given \( q_{\text{soln}} = +9240 \) J, substitute into the formula: \( q_{\text{rxn}} = - 9240 \) J.
